    An Historical and Topical Note on Convection in Porous Media

    Source: Journal of Heat Transfer:;2013:;volume( 135 ):;issue: 006::page 61201
    Author:
    Nield, D. A.
    ,
    Kuznetsov, A. V.
    DOI: 10.1115/1.4023567
    Publisher: The American Society of Mechanical Engineers (ASME)
    Abstract: This note deals with three main themes. The first is a discussion of the early literature on convection in porous media. The second is a brief overview of current analytical modeling of singlephase convection in saturated porous media and in composite fluid/porousmedium domains. The third is a brief discussion of some pertinent recent studies involving nanofluids, cellular porous materials, bidisperse and tridisperse porous media.
